Cohort 5

Jurisdiction: Hometown Strong

University: NC A&T

Hometown: Winston-Salem, NC

Brittany Wilborn is serving her fellowship as a policy assistant with Hometown Strong in the Office of the Governor. She graduated from North Carolina A&T State University with a bachelor’s degree in liberal studies and a pre-law concentration. Wilborn was previously involved in nonprofit work, providing resources to those in need in her local community.
